‍What’s the Need to Automate Instagram Activities

Check out the list below to know the amazing use-case of automation in Instagram-:

‍Automate Repeated Tasks

Instagram automation enables you to handle repetitive tasks with minimal effort.

Instead of spending hours every day, you can automate things like:

  1. Posting content
  2. Following or unfollowing accounts
  3. Commenting on posts
  4. Responding to DMs

All these tasks get managed automatically, so you save time and can focus more on creating content and growing your account.

‍Automated Personalized Messages 

Responding quickly to comments and DMs is key to keeping your audience engaged and feeling valued. But as your account grows, replying to everyone manually can be tough.

With automation, you can:

  • Send instant replies to common questions
  • Welcome new followers with a personalized DM
  • Handle basic customer support queries automatically

This ensures your audience always gets a timely response, while you save time and focus on building deeper connections.

‍Target Specific Audience

Instagram automation helps you reach the right people instead of everyone. By setting smart rules, you can focus on users who are more likely to engage with your brand and become followers.

With targeting automation, you can:

  • Set parameters by hashtags (reach users engaging with relevant topics)
  • Target by location (show content to people in specific cities or areas)
  • Filter by interests (find users who follow similar niches)
  • Reach competitor followers (people already engaging with similar brands)

This ensures your content reaches those most likely to be interested, increasing quality engagement and follower growth.

ManyChat’s clean, intuitive interface makes mapping chat paths simple. Its growth tools let people start conversations from posts and Stories and enter your chatbot flow naturally, so it doesn’t feel like a bot.

  • Flow Builder: Drag-and-drop automated chat paths.
  • Keyword Triggers: DM a word (e.g., “eBook”) to launch a flow.
  • Comments Automation: Auto-like/reply; send DMs with randomized responses.
  • Story Mentions: Instant replies when someone mentions you.
  • Conversation Starters: Route FAQs, promos, shipping queries to the right flow.
  • Info Capture: Store user details for future campaigns.
  • Live Chat: Unlimited agents with a unified inbox and context.
  • Integrations: Mailchimp, Klaviyo, Shopify, Google Sheets, Zapier.

FAQs

1. Why should small businesses automate their Instagram activities?

Automation saves time on repetitive tasks like posting, responding to DMs, and tracking performance. This allows small businesses to focus more on content creation and strategy while staying consistent.

2. Is Instagram automation safe to use?

Yes, when you use trusted tools that follow Instagram’s policies. Reputable platforms focus on safe automation such as scheduling, analytics, and engagement management, without risking account bans.

3. Can automation help me grow my Instagram followers?

Definitely. Features like targeted engagement (based on hashtags, locations, or competitor followers) help you reach the right audience, improving both follower count and quality engagement.

4. Which Instagram tasks can be automated?

You can automate content posting, scheduling, hashtag research, replying to FAQs, sending welcome DMs, tracking analytics, and even handling bulk customer queries.

5. Are these tools expensive for small businesses?

Most Instagram automation tools offer flexible pricing plans. Options like Later, Buffer, or SocialPilot have affordable tiers for startups, while advanced platforms like Sprout Social may suit larger businesses.

6. How do I choose the right Instagram automation tool?

It depends on your needs. If you want scheduling, choose tools like Later or Buffer. For engagement and messaging, ManyChat works well. For analytics and advanced insights, Sprout Social is a great option.
